About the Role

Within the role, you will lead and deliver strategic communications projects that enhance and protect the University’s profile, reputation, and brand. The role involves developing and delivering impactful communications plans across PR, media relations, internal communications, digital and social media channels, managing press office activity and media enquiries, and supporting crisis communications.

You will create and oversee engaging content and campaigns, work with external PR agencies, and collaborate closely with academic and professional services to identify positive stories and support departmental communication needs.

About Bath Spa University

Bath Spa University is where creative minds meet. Offering a wide range of courses across the arts, sciences, education, social science and business to over 7,500 students, the University employs outstanding creative professionals which support its aim to be a leading educational institution in creativity, culture and enterprise.

Our main Newton park campus is based in stunning countryside just a few minutes from a World Heritage City. We are also proud to offer courses to students at our other campuses around Bath, and in London at our Canary Wharf and Hackney sites.
